"If you’re in Sarasota and craving a hearty, home-style meal with a touch of Amish tradition, head over to Der Dutchman in the Pinecraft area.
It’s a cozy spot, with large and nice dining rooms and yummy bakery.
The buffet is loaded with all the comfort food as crispy fried chicken, roast beef, mashed potatoes, homemade noodles, and a big salad bar. You can also order from the menu, and it’s just as good.
The pies are very popular and so many flavors as Coconut cream, peanut butter, cherry and others.
The bakery attached to the restaurant is worth a stop, Stock up on cinnamon rolls, donuts, or fresh bread.
Local products and Amish traditional items, their own brand of foods as honey, sauces and and ice cream, beef jerky, pop corn and more.
There are all kind of gifts and products on beautiful displays.
There is a big gift shop on the second floor that we didn’t visit this time.
Resting and sitting areas for after your big meal as well.
Very open, spacious and clean, country style charm inviting and comfortable.
laid-back and family-friendly. The staff are kind and efficient, everything is well organized and runs smoothly.
Definitely a nice traditional experience in the area for the whole family."

Der Dutchman crowned best buffet in the US
Dutchman Hospitality, Der Dutchman's parent company, headquartered in Walnut Creek, Ohio, opened its first Der Dutchman Restaurant 54 years ago. The restaurant features foods that pay homage to the Midwest Amish and Mennonite traditions, a press release states, including chicken, noodles, dressing and mashed potatoes.

What to Eat in Sarasota
And at Yoder's Restaurant and Der Dutchman Restaurant, which reside in the city's Pinecraft neighborhood, diners can sample traditional Amish and Mennonite items, including pecan sticky buns, potato cakes and shoofly pie (a dessert with a coffee cake topping and a molasses bottom).
